Architecture

Blockchain dependencies within cryptocurrency, options trading, and financial derivatives fundamentally relate to the underlying system design and its capacity to support complex financial instruments. A robust architecture mitigates systemic risk by ensuring data integrity and operational resilience across distributed ledgers, influencing the reliability of derivative valuations and settlement processes. Scalability limitations within specific blockchain architectures directly constrain the throughput of decentralized exchanges and the execution of high-frequency trading strategies involving crypto-based options. Consequently, architectural choices impact the feasibility of deploying sophisticated quantitative models and maintaining efficient market microstructure.
